    גִּרְגֵּר, גִּירְגֵּר 1) (denom. of גָּרוֹן, גַּרְגֶּרֶת) to pour down the throat, opp. שתה to set the lips to the vessel. Par. IX, 4; Tosef. ib. IX (VIII), 6.Gitt.89a גִּירְגְּרָה בשוק if she quaffs outdoors; (Rashi: walks with outstretched neck (גָּרוֹן)). 2) denom. of גַּרְגַּר) to pick single berries. Maasr. II, 6 מְגַרְגֵּר ואוכל he may pick grapes (from the hanging cluster) and eat; ib. III, 9; Y. ib. II, 50a top. 3) (denom. of גְּרוֹגֶרֶת) to let the olive shrivel (on the tree or in the sun on the roof), to mark out for shrivelling. Ex. R. s. 36 that olivewhile it is yet on its tree, מְגַרְגְּרִין אותו they mark it out for shrivelling (in order to use it for the press). Men.VIII, 4 מְגַרְגְּרוֹ בראש הזית he lets it shrivel on the top of the olive tree; מג׳ בראש הגג in the sun on the roof; (for oth. opin. v. Rashi a. l..Ib. 86a מְגרְגְּרוֹ תנן או מְגַלְגְּלֹו תנן does it read mgargro (he lets it shrivel) or mgalglo (he lets it hang until it is fully rounded)?

    אוי, אָוָהII (b. h., √אה, cmp. הא; v. חָוָה a. Ges. H. Dict. s. v. אָוָה III) to point, mark. Denom. אֹות II, תְּאָו, תַּאֲוָה. Hithpa. הִתְאַוֶּה (denom. of תַּאֲוָה, תְּאָו) to mark, to mark out. Koh. R. to XII, 7 התחיל מִתְאַוֶּה תאוים he began to put up marks.

    סָמַן(b. h. Nif.), Pi. סִימֵּן (denom. of סִימָן) to mark. Koh. R. to XII, 10, (read:) שלש סימנים סִימַּנְתִּי לך בקבורתווכ׳ ( וסיימתי לך, being a gloss) three signs did I mark out for thee with regard to the grave of Moses; Midr. Till. (to Ps. 9 (not סימנתין).Part. pass. מְסוּמָּן; pl. מְסוּמָּנִים, מְסוּמָּנִין. B. Bath. X, 7 (172a) אם היו מ׳ (Y. ed. אם היו בסימנין; Ms. M. אם היו סימנין, v. Rabb. D. S. a. l. note) if the two persons of the same name bear also the same marks.

    תָּאוm. (b. h. תָּו; v. אָוָה II) mark.Pl. תָּאוִים, תָּאוִוים. Koh. R. to XII, 7 (ed. Wil. תְּוָואִים, fr. תָּוָה), v. אָוָה II. Lev. R. s. 18 התחיל מתאוה תוואיםוכ׳ he begins to mark out limits, (saying,) as far as such a place I can walk ; Kob. R. to XII, 5 מתווה תוואים.

    סָרַט(b. h. שָׂרַט; contr. of סחרט, Saf. of חָרַט) to make an incision; to mark. Tosef.Sabb.XI (XII), 6 הסוֹרֵט סריטהוכ׳ he who draws one mark over two boards at the same time; (Sabb.103b שָׂרַט שריטה). Gen. R. s. 33, end יִסְרוֹט לו סריטהוכ׳ let him make a mark on the wall (indicating the standing of the sun) Ex. R. s. 12, beg. ס׳ לו סריטהוכ׳ (Tanḥ. Vaëra 16 ש׳ לו שריטה) he drew a mark for him on the wall Lam. R. introd. (Zabdi 2); ib. to IV, 12 (ref. to Is. 10:19) ששה שכן … להיות שׂורֵט שריטה six were left over, for that is a childs way to make a stroke (resembling ו = six); (Midr. Till. to Ps. 79, beg.; v. ed. Bub. note 2 1); a. fr.Esp. to wound the body in mourning, v. שָׂרַט. Pi. סֵירֵט same. Sabb.XII, 4 המְסָרֵט על בשרו he who makes a mark on his body by scratching, contrad. to הכותב. Sot.48a (expl. נוקפין) שהיו מְסָרְטִין לעגלוכ׳ they used to make a scratch between the calfs horns, that the blood might run over its eyes; (Tosef.Sot.XIII, 10 שמכין, ed. Zuck. שמושכין). Ex. R. s. 24 שאילולי היה … ומְשָׂרֶטֶת אותו if a man were to eat (and swallow) a piece of bread in its natural condition (not softened by the moisture of saliva), it would enter his entrails and wound him; a. e.Tosef.B. Mets. III, 29 משרבטין ומסרטין, strike out ומסרטין as a corrupt dittography of משרבטין; v. ed. Zuck.V. שָׂרַט. Nif. נִסְרַט, Hithpa. הִסְתָּרֵט to be scratched, wounded. Sabb.53b כדי שלא יִסָּרְטוּ דדיהן that their udders may not be scratched (when passing between bushes). Ex. R. s. 2 וכשהוא מוציאה מִסְתָּרֶטֶת but when he takes his hand out, it will be wounded.

    חוֹתָםm. (b. h.; חָתַם) 1) seal, stamp, die; enclosure locked up with a mark. Sabb.VIII, 5 כח׳ המרצופין as much sealing clay as required for a seal on bags. Ib. ח׳ האיגרות seal on letters. Snh.IV, 5 אדם טובע … בח׳ אחד a human being prints many coins from one die, but the Lord טבע … בחוֹתָמוֹ שלוכ׳ stamped every human being with the die of Adam, and yet not one is like the other; Y. Ib. IV, 22b bot. מח׳וכ׳. Sabb.58a העבד בח׳ שבצוארו the slave with the mark hanging down from his neck, בח׳ שבכסותו with the mark tied to his garment; a. fr.Trnsf. sexual innocence, purity. Yalk. Num. 766, v. infra.Pl. חוֹתָמוֹת, חוֹתָמִים. Y. Snh. l. c.Bets.31b ח׳ שבקרקעוכ׳ knots which serve as marks on doors of subterranean stores, may be untied ; a. e.Tan. dbe El. ch. XX, בחֹותָמֵיהֶן in their innocence. 2) ( lock, the oblate side of a berry to which the stalk is attached. Y.Ab. Zar. V, 44d top. Toh. X, 5 גרגר … ח׳ a single berry, if its oblate part with the stalk is intact; Tosef. Ib. XI, 10. Ib. מקום ח׳ the place where the stalk (now torn out) was seated (and where now juice is oozing out). 3) the membraneous enclosure separating the stone of a date from its flesh, pericarp (as far as not eatable). Tosef.Ḥull.I, 23 הח׳ טמא ביבשה quot. by R. S. to Ukts. II, 2 (ed. Zuck. הח׳ omitted; oth. ed. הזיתים in place of the preceding העמים) the pericarp is counted in with the unclean matter in dry dates; Ukts. l. c. ח׳ של יבשה R. S. (ed. a.     סִימָןm. (סוּם I, v. םוּמָא II) mark, sign; omen; symptom; cipher, mnemotechnical note. B. Mets.22b ס׳ העשוי לידרס לא הוי ס׳ a mark (on a lost object) which is liable to be effaced by treading upon it, is no mark (by which one can claim it). Ib. 23a ס׳ הבא מאליו an accidental mark (not made purposely). Ib. 24b נתן בה ס׳ he told a sign (by which he identified it). Ib. 27b ס׳ מובהק a distinguished (specific) mark of identification.Ber.24b ס׳ יפה an auspicious omen. Taan.30b אינו דוֹאה סִימַן ברכהוכ׳ will never see a sign of blessing (will labor without success).Kidd.16b דברי הכל ס׳ all agree that it is a sign of puberty. Ḥull.61a עוף הבא בס׳ אחד a bird which has one of the four marks of cleanness. Erub.54b (ref. to שימה, Deut. 31:19) א״ת שימה אלא סִימָנָהּ read not simah (put it), but simanah (its mark, catchwords). Ib. 54a, a. fr. (editorial gloss) ס׳וכ׳ the catchwords for the subject following are ; a. v. fr.Trnsf. the organ, the cutting of which is an indication that the animal has been slaughtered according to the ritual, the windpipe and the gullet. Ḥull.27b הכשרו בס׳ אחד is made ritually fit for eating by the cutting of either of the organs; a. fr.Pl. סִימָנִים, סִימָנִין. B. Mets.27a, a. fr. ס׳ דאורייתאוכ׳ is identification by marks a Biblical or a rabbinical institution? Ib. II, 5 שיש בה ס׳ which can be identified by signs. Ib. 7 אמר אבידה ולא אמר סִימָנֶיהָ if he states the object he has lost, but cannot describe it.Kidd.4a, a. fr. סִימָנֵי נערות evidences of puberty (v. נַעֲרוּת). Ib. 16a קונה את עצמה בס׳ acquires herself (becomes free) on showing evidences of puberty. Ib. b אין ס׳ באיש a man-servant does not go out free on reaching puberty. Ḥull.III, 6 סימני בהמהוכ׳ the distinguishing marks of cleanness in animals Ib. 27b לחייבו בשני ס׳ to make it obligatory to cut both organs (the windpipe and the gullet). Ib. 44a עיקור ס׳ the case of the organs being torn loose before cutting. Erub.54b אין התורה … בס׳ knowledge of the Law can be obtained only by means of signs (rubrication by catchwords). Ib. 21b סימני טעמים notes of accentuation (v. טַעַם); a. fr.

    מצי, מָצָה(מָצָא) (b. h.) to squeeze, wring, esp. to wring out the blood of the bird sacrifice. Sifra Vayikra, Ndab., ch. VIII, Par. 7 הזא מוֹצֶה he wrings it; a. fr. Pi. מִיצָּה, מִצָּה 1) same. Zeb.VI, 5, sq.; a. fr. 2) to pour out to the last drop, to drain. Ib. 64b מי כתיב יְמַצֶּה יִמָּצֵהוכ׳ (ed. punctuate יַמְצֶה, Hif.) it does not say (Lev. 5:9), ‘he shall pour out (the remainder) at the bottom, but ‘it shall be wrung out, which means, that it will run out to the bottom of itself. Ter. XI, 8 הִרְכִּינָהּ ומִיצָּה (Y. ed. ומִיצֵּת; Ms. M. ומִצֵּת) if he bent the vessel and drained it; B. Bath.87b (Ms. H. a. R. ומיצת); ib. V, 8 (87a) הרכינה ומיצה (Y. ed. ומצת; Bab. ed. ומִיצֵּית, Ms. M. ומִוצֵּת; Ms. R. ומִיצְּתָהּ). Gen. R. s. 85; s. 92 (play on מצא, Gen. 44:16) כזה שהוא מְמַצֶּהוכ׳ as one drains a vessel and leaves nothing but the lees. Midr. Till. to Ps. 59 (play on מצא, Prov. 18:22) כשהאשה רעה היא מְמַצָּה (כל) הטובות כולן מביתווכ׳ ed. Bub. (oth. ed. ממַצֶּאֶת, a. oth. variants) when the wife is bad, she drains all the good things out of his house and makes him poor; Yalk. Prov. 957 ממציא (read: מְמַצֵּית); a. fr. 3) (cmp. מָצַע) מ׳ מידות to measure exactly. Erub.IV, 11 (52b) אין המשוחות מְמַצִּיןוכ׳ the surveyors (in marking distances for Sabbath limits) do not measure exactly (but mark within the limits), in order to allow for mistakes.Trnsf. to sound ones learning. Men.18a למַצֹּות מידותי to have my own learning examined; למ׳ מידותיווכ׳ to sound the learning of Hithpa. מִתְמַצֶּה to be wrung out; to be emptied, drained Sifra Vayikra, Ḥob., Par. 10, ch. XVIII; Zeb.64b שהשירין מִתְמְצִּים ליסוד where the remainder is poured out towards the bottom of the altar; a. fr. (Ib. VI, 4 (64b) היה מתמצה, read מְמַצֶּה, v. Rabb. D. S. a. l. note 50.Y.R. Hash. I, 56d top; Y.Shek.III, beg.47b עד כאן הן מִתְמַצּוֹת לילדוכ׳ up to that time (the first of Elul) the latest births of the old year (of those conceived before the first of Nisan) take place Trnsf. (with חשבון) to be exactly counted, to be finally settled. Y.Sot.I, 17a (he suffers a loss by the death of his ox) והחשבון מִתְמַצֶּה and the account (of his sins) is settled; ib.; Num. R. s. 9 אחת מתארעאוכ׳, v. אָרַע I; Koh. R. to VII, 27.
